My younger son and I have been out a few times this season.
We've let dozens of does and small bucks walk, but not last night.
Last night was the first hunt of what was supposed to be a 3 day trip, it got cut short with one well placed shot.
My son took this 185lb, 11pt at 105 yards while it was trotting after a doe, he was facing away and moving uphill, he slowed and turned a bit when a smaller buck tried to follow... BANG!
A .308 150gr JSP fired from a Savage 110 dropped his ass in his tracks.

My son was elated at both the buck, which is a really good one for South Bama, and his shot.
The decision was made to get this one mounted, son is getting a left turn, semi-sneak with the ears alert and wide eyes.
No freezer room and warmer temps meant that we left this morning to get this guy to the taxidermy man immediately.
Cut the trip short, but it's worth it for my son's new trophy.
